Introduction to Health and Safety Analytics

Health and safety analytics involves the use of statistical methods and techniques to analyze data related to workplace incidents, hazards, and risks. The primary goal of health and safety analytics is to identify trends, patterns, and correlations that can inform decision-making and drive improvements in workplace safety. By applying health and safety analytics best practices, organizations can reduce the risk of incidents, improve compliance with regulatory requirements, and enhance their overall safety culture.

Importance of Data-Driven Insights

Data-driven insights are essential in health and safety analytics, as they provide a factual basis for decision-making. By analyzing data on incidents, near-misses, and other safety-related events, organizations can identify areas for improvement and develop targeted strategies to mitigate risks. Health and safety analytics best practices emphasize the importance of using data to inform decision-making, rather than relying on intuition or anecdotal evidence.

Key Concepts in Health and Safety Analytics Best Practices

Several key concepts are central to health and safety analytics best practices, including incident reporting, risk assessment, and data analysis. Incident reporting involves the systematic collection and recording of data on workplace incidents, including injuries, illnesses, and near-misses. Risk assessment involves the identification and evaluation of potential hazards and risks in the workplace, while data analysis involves the use of statistical methods to identify trends and patterns in safety-related data.

Risk Assessment and Management

  • Identify potential hazards and risks in the workplace
  • Evaluate the likelihood and potential impact of each hazard or risk
  • Develop and implement controls to mitigate or manage each hazard or risk

Applying Health and Safety Analytics in the Workplace

Applying health and safety analytics in the workplace involves using data-driven insights to inform decision-making and drive improvements in safety. This can involve analyzing data on incident rates, injury types, and other safety-related metrics to identify areas for improvement. Health and safety analytics best practices also emphasize the importance of communicating safety information to employees, contractors, and other stakeholders, and of continuously monitoring and evaluating the effectiveness of safety controls and procedures.

Communication and Training

Effective communication and training are critical components of health and safety analytics best practices. Organizations should ensure that all employees, contractors, and other stakeholders are aware of their roles and responsibilities in maintaining a safe work environment, and that they have the necessary skills and knowledge to perform their jobs safely.
